H. S. Garcha is a scholar working on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Molecular Biology and Cognitive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, H. S. Garcha has authored 26 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 18 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, 13 papers in Molecular Biology and 8 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in H. S. Garcha's work include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(12 papers),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(12 papers) and Nicotinic Acetylcholine Receptors Study (11 papers). H. S. Garcha is often cited by papers focused on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(12 papers),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(12 papers) and Nicotinic Acetylcholine Receptors Study (11 papers). H. S. Garcha coll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Poland. H. S. Garcha's co-authors include Ian P. Stolerman, G. Ettlinger, Julian Pratt, Ramesh Kumar, V. Giardini, Nawazish Mirza, C. Reavill, I.C. Rose, C Feyerabend and C. J. Chandler and has published in prestigious journals such as Brain, Brain Research and British Journal of Pharmacology.
